William Gather Ramsey, 82, of Erwin Route 2, died at his home last Thursday, November 30, 1950 at 2:15 a.m. after a lingering illness.
A native of Madison County, North Carolina, he is survived by his wife, three sons, Henry and Wade of Erwin, and Porter Ramsey of Unicoi; three daughters, Mrs. Franklin Lloyd, Miss Bessie Ramsey and Mrs. Jack Lewis, all of Erwin; a brother, Tommy Ramsey, Danville, Virginia; two sisters, Mrs. Andy Fender, Mrs. William Davis, Flag Pond; 35 grandchildren and eight great-grandchildren.
Funeral services were at Laurel Bend Church, Route 2, Erwin, Saturday at 2:30 p.m. Burial was in Ivy Ridge, North Carolina. The Rev. McKinley Franklin officiating.
